
Artifacts is built around the idea of rare and desirable loot, for which it truly makes sense to go underground. The mod adds powerful trinkets and special items, but its main feature is the way they are obtained. Instead of ordinary chests, the player here is often met by mimics, which disguise themselves as loot and then suddenly switch to attacking.

TrimsEffects offers a very successful rethinking of armor trims. Where they previously worked mainly as a cosmetic system, there is now a practical reason to take them seriously. Each trim begins to give a permanent effect, which means that choosing a pattern turns not only into a question of appearance, but also into an element of the character’s build.

Coins JE solves a problem that arises especially often in cooperative play: how to conveniently evaluate items when trading between players. Instead of informal agreements, the mod introduces a clear currency system with coins of different values. Thanks to this, trading becomes simpler, more transparent, and more convenient, especially on servers where ordinary barter quickly begins to confuse the participants.

Animal Garden Meerkat adds noticeably more character to savannas through one, at first glance, small mob. Here, meerkats are shown not just as background decoration for the biome: they can be tamed, reproduce quite easily, and after being tamed become defenders. This combination makes it a pleasant mod at the intersection of atmosphere and usefulness.

Stronger Snowballs has an extremely clear idea, and this is its advantage. It takes an almost useless item in the regular game and gives it a specific combat function. After installing the mod, snowballs begin to slow the target for a short time, and fire mobs such as magma cubes and blazes take damage from them.

Underwater Village Oceanic Structures makes oceans more interesting through new underwater buildings. Towers, temples, libraries, and other structures add not only visual variety to the sea depths, but also a feeling of hidden history. The mod is perceived especially well thanks to the fact that all structures are made from vanilla blocks.
